- [ ] Step 7: Archive cold storage buckets (Glacierline tier). Confirm both ceremony witnesses are present, verify bucket manifests match the Oxbow ledger, then seal the archive key shares. Plugin authors may observe but not handle shares. Once sealed, the archive index itself is encrypted and can only be reopened with the passphrase below.

vault phrase of badup-hahig = tamael-aldael-kelmir-istael-fenok-istwyn-tamius-jorath-oliion

Quarterly Planning Note — Warranty Costs on the Fenwick Range

Heads of department: warranty spend on the Fenwick 300 series came in roughly 40% over plan this quarter, mostly down to the hinge assembly issue flagged by Priya's team. The fix is in production now, but we'll carry elevated claims for another two quarters. Please build that into your Q-plans and hold discretionary spend where you can. How this affects our broader roadmap is set out in the confidential note below.

confidential, kagep-kahof: Druokax Systems plans to lower the Ulaath list price by 53 percent in March.

On-call: the TallyGate counters at the north gates of Kettlemoor Arena are reporting entry totals roughly 4% below the south gates under identical load. Investigation shows the north-gate units are running a locally modified configuration — debounce interval and double-pass detection thresholds were changed during last season's troubleshooting and never reverted to the managed baseline. Until we redeploy, expect undercounting alerts on match nights. The drifted values currently live on the north-gate units are as follows.

service settings:
[casax]
port = 6379
team = rusir
host = casax.zemvarhq.corp
region = outer-4
access_code = ac_9808ce
timeout_ms = 1500

Subject: DR drill this Thursday — admin dashboard dark mode

Hello plugin authors,

As part of Thursday's disaster-recovery drill, the Glintboard admin dashboard will be restored from backup in the secondary region. Dark-mode support ships in this build, so please verify your plugin panels render correctly under both themes during the drill window. You'll need temporary access to the drill environment; unlock it with the recovery passphrase provided below.

recovery phrase for fawif-tajeg: norael-aldmir-casir-brivan-ulaion